I guess the idea is a bulletin board, originally: to post a note, as one does with paper on a bulletin board. "Sign" in Latin could be nota or index, and there are corresponding verbs notare and indicare.

To affix something is suffigere, and to place, collocare. Adstruere can to be build on top of, to add on, to contribute, and is also plausible, though perhaps not quite as germane.

To start a thread: filum or colloquium or sermonem incipere.
